摘要
介绍了以粉煤灰为原料进行发泡和憎水处理制取保温憎水材料的新工艺,对发泡剂、稳泡剂及憎水剂的种类、掺量、发泡温度等影响产品质量的因素进行了试验研究,同时探讨了发泡与憎水机理。并在实验室研究的基础上,介绍了发泡粉煤灰保温憎水材料中试生产概况。
A new technology for preparation of heat-insulation and hydrophobic materials by use of foaming fly ash as a raw material was described in this article. The influence of kind and dosage of the foaming agent, foam-stabilization agent and hydrophobing agent on the quality of the product obtained was examined. The mechanisms of foaming and hydrophobic action were also explored. On the basis of laboratory research, the pilot test of the heat-insulation and hydrophobic material prepared by use of foaming fly ash is carried out.
